Suzuki Australia Wants Made-In-India Grand Vitara – Report

Maruti Suzuki has confirmed that the new Grand Vitara 5-seater SUV will be unveiled on July 20, 2022. The new model will come with segment-first four-wheel-drive system. A new media report claims that Suzuki Australia is pushing Japan hard to bring the new Grand Vitara in for the Australian market.

The new Grand Vitara has been developed by Suzuki; however, it will be produced at Toyota’s manufacturing facility in Bidadi, Karnataka. In fact, Toyota will soon launch its own version of the Grand Vitara called the Urban Cruiser HyRyder. The new model will be powered by 1.5-litre mild hybrid and 1.5-litre strong hybrid engines, and the former will be available with all-wheel-drive setup.

Suzuki was selling the old Grand Vitara in Australia between 1999 and 2018. It was offered with both two-and four-door bodies. Thanks to the compact body, an off-road-ready chassis and low-range gearing, the Grand Vitara was hugely popular among Australian customers.

The new Suzuki Vitara is basically a city SUV targeting young buyers who want higher seating position and all-wheel-drive capabilities. The Suzuki Jimny is also on sale in Australia. It is smaller and more rugged model. Suzuki is also developing a 5-door version of the Jimny, which has recently been caught testing in Europe.

Suzuki Grand Vitara India

Maruti Suzuki has started accepting pre-orders for the new Grand Vitara at a token amount of Rs 11,000. The new model will be sold through NEXA premium dealership network. The SUV will take on the likes of the Hyundai Creta, Kia Seltos, MG Astor, VW Taigun and the Skoda Kushaq. It is based on Suzuki’s Global-C platform that underpins the new Brezza, S-Cross & the global Vitara.

The SUV will come with two engine options – a 1.5L K15C dualjet petrol with mild hybrid & a Toyota’s 1.5L TNGA Atkinson cycle petrol with strong hybrid tech. The former is good with 101bhp and 137Nm, and will come with 5-speed manual & a 6-speed torque convertor automatic gearbox. The 1.5L Atkinson cycle engine produces 92bhp and 122Nm. It is coupled to an electric motor that offers 79bhp and 141Nm. The combined power output stands at 117bhp and 141Nm of torque.  It features a 177.6V lithium-ion battery and claims to offer an electric only range of up to 25km. It will be paired to a Toyota’s e-drive transmission.
